ORDER
This petition has been filed seeking direction to direct the respondents 1 and 2 to accord police protection to the petitioner to carry on the coumpund wall construction in the Property in S.NO. 1816, R.S. No. 146/10B, Ezhudesom Village, Vilanvancode Taluk, Kanyakumari District admeasuring 14.65 cents based on the complaint dated 14.06.2019
2. It is seen that the third and fourth respondents already filed a suit in O.S.No.547 of 2010 on the file of the District Munsif, Kulithurai. for injunction in respect of property belonging to the petitioner, comprised in S.No.1816, R.S.No.146/10B admeasuring 5.5 cents situated at Ezhudesom Village, Vilanvancode Taluk, Kanyakumari District and the same was dismissed. In the said suit petitioner filed Interlocutory Application in I.A.No.32 of 2014 to reject the plaint and the same was allowed and confirmed the right of the petitioner. As against which, the third and fourth respondents filed an appeal which is still pending.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 1/2
Crl.O.P.(MD) No.12977 of 2019
3. Considering the above facts and circumstances of the case the second respondent is directed to conduct enquiry on the the complaint lodged by the petitioner with the counter part namely the fourth respondent and pass orders on merits and in accordance with law within a period of four we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.
4. With the above direction the Criminal Original Petition stands disposed of.
